    Cluster This is suitable for business graphics such as charts, graphs and drawings, since this creates sharper printouts. Moreover, the processing time is shorter. Color Enhance Selecting Color Enhance/True2Life ON enables the True2Life feature. This feature analyzes your image to improve quality sharpness, white balance and color density.
  • Page 13: Color/Mono

    Color/Mono This selection allows a color document to be printed in mono only. Bi-Directional Printing When Bi-Directional Printing is selected, the print head prints in both directions and offers faster print speeds. When it is not selected the print head prints in one direction only and provides higher print quality.

    Simultaneous Printing/Faxing Your machine can print data from your computer while sending or receiving a fax, or while scanning information into the computer. However, when the machine is copying or receiving a fax on paper, it pauses the PC printing operation, and then resumes printing when copying or fax receiving is finished.
